Cosworth has finalised its acquisition of Silverstone-based electrification specialists Delta, strengthening the company’s position at the heart of the transport technology revolution.
Formal completion of the Delta acquisition allows Cosworth to accelerate its offering in electrification. It also affords Cosworth a location at the heart of the UK’s high-performance technology cluster, Silverstone.
Through Delta’s expertise, Cosworth can meet the evolving needs of its customers as they transition to hybrid, EV and fuel cell configurations. Delta’s industry-leading work in battery systems, control systems, electric/hybrid drivetrains, full vehicle programmes, lightweight structures and simulation are a perfect complement to Cosworth’s existing solutions.
Innovative battery and EV solutions are shaping the future of transport. It is here where Cosworth can reinforce its position as a trusted and innovative partner for OEMs globally. Delta’s state-of-the-art facilities allow for advanced development of bespoke battery modules across a multitude of industries, not least automotive, marine and defence.
Cosworth CEO Hal Reisiger said: “The acquisition of Delta marks a pivotal moment for Cosworth as we advance our offering in the electrification space. We are pleased to welcome Delta into the Cosworth Group, and to integrate their expertise and patented intellectual property into our portfolio, alongside our existing capabilities. As a growing business, we continue to explore additional opportunities to accelerate our roadmap to electrification and increase our technology portfolio.”

About Delta
Delta are electrified powertrain specialists, based at the world-famous Silverstone Circuit, in the heart of the UK’s high performance technology cluster. Delta has three main development streams: battery systems, its catalytic generator and platform master control. Each is approached with the same robust but lightweight methodology, honed through decades spent in the high-pressure motorsport sector. Wrapped around these three streams is also a vehicle engineering and integration capability that has seen Delta deliver many whole vehicle projects, for start-ups and OEMs alike. Delta’s multidisciplinary team supports a wide range of sectors and its capability covers services from initial concept through to low volume production.
